Purpose
Investigate the use of Cloudify Community edition - specifically http://cloudify.co/community/ in bringing up ONAP on Kubernetes using TOSCA blueprints on top of Helm. The white paper and blog article detail running hybrid Kubernetes and non-Kubernetes deployment together via http://cloudify.co/cloudify.co/2017/09/27/model-driven-onap-operations-manager-oom-boarding-tosca-cloudify/
TOSCA: https://www.oasis-open.org/committees/tc_home.php?wg_abbrev=tosca
One use case where Cloudify would be used as a layer above OOM and Kubernetes - is if you wish to run one of your databases - for example the MariaDB instance outside of the managed kubernetes environment (possibly as part of a phased in migration into kubernetes) - in this case you would need an external cloud controller to manage this hybrid environment - we will attempt to simulate this use case.
Quickstart
Here are the step to to deploy ONAP on Kubenetes using TOSCA and Cloudify:
- Install Cloudify manager, the fastest way is to use an existing Image for your environment (OpenStack, AWS, etc.)
- http://cloudify.co/download/
- Here are detailed instruction per environment (choose the non-bootstrap option) https://github.com/cloudify-examples/cloudify-environment-setup
- Provision a Kubernetes Cluster using https://github.com/cloudify-examples/simple-kubernetes-blueprint
Here is a link https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=mKmyXFc7j14 for a video that describes the process of provisioning a Kubernetes cluster. - After the Kubernetes cluster is up, provision ONAP using the following TOSCA blueprint (Link to be provided soon)
